OmniFocus Web Subscription

I note that OmniFocus are offering a web service for 49.99 a year. In addition to the cost of their apps. Alternatively you can get the apps included for 99.99 a year

I got off the OmniFocus bandwagon with the last release. I was always getting overwhelmed. Is this a step too far in terms of cost ? Other apps charge a lower subscription e.g todoist, Evernote and the apps are included

